idbm: Fix memory leak and NULL pointer dereference in idbm_rec_update_param()
Three memory issues in this function:
1. did not verify return value of calloc(), strdup() or malloc();
2. memory leak of pointer tmp_value caused strsep()
tmp_value would change after strsep() and free(tmp_value) would
cause memory leak;
3. memory leak of pointer "found", the memory was allocated but did
not freed
